Description
Comedic Arena Action
Bouncy Arena Party Clash focuses on humorous movement rather than serious competition. Players control wobbly characters that stumble, bounce, and wobble across a bright arena. The goal is to land five scoring touches on an opponent before they do the same to you. Each match is short, often lasting just a few minutes, which keeps the experience light and energetic. The silly physics of the characters add unpredictability, making every round feel fresh and amusing.
Energy Management Mechanics
Every action in the arena consumes energy from a visible bar. Throwing a hit, dodging, or dashing all cost energy, so players must think before they act. If the energy bar empties, the character becomes sluggish and easier to target. This system discourages random button pressing and rewards careful timing. Learning to balance offense with energy conservation is the key to outlasting opponents. The mechanic is simple enough for newcomers but offers depth for those who want to improve.

Flexible Play Modes
Bouncy Arena Party Clash includes two primary ways to play. In single-player mode, you face an AI opponent that adapts to your play style. In local two-player mode, two people share the same screen and compete directly. This setup makes the game ideal for family gatherings or quick breaks. Both modes use the same simple controls, so switching between them requires no additional learning. The lack of online multiplayer keeps the focus on local, social play.
Accessibility and Platform Support
The game is designed to be easy to pick up. Controls work with keyboard inputs on PC and touch gestures on mobile devices. There is no complicated tutorial or steep learning curve. The short match length means you can play for five minutes or an hour without commitment. This accessibility makes it suitable for casual gamers, young children, and older adults alike. The game runs smoothly on standard web browsers and modern mobile hardware.
